Evanescence’s Sanctuary Is Finally Here

Evanescence’s Sanctuary Is Finally Here

The wait is over. Sanctuary, the new studio album from Evanescence, has officially arrived.

Released today through BMG, Sanctuary marks the band’s first full-length studio album since 2021’s The Bitter Truth. The album was produced by Jordan Fish, Zakk Cervini, and Nick Raskulinecz, bringing together Evanescence’s signature sound with new influences and fresh creative energy.

Fans got their first taste of the new era with the release of “Who Will You Follow” in April, followed by a steady stream of interviews, magazine features, and previews leading up to release day. Early reviews have been overwhelmingly positive, with critics praising the album’s confidence, evolution, and powerful performances.

Early Reviews Praise Evanescence’s Sanctuary

Early Reviews Praise Evanescence’s Sanctuary

With just days to go until the release of Sanctuary on June 5, early reviews for Evanescence’s sixth studio album are beginning to appear, and the response has been overwhelmingly positive.

One of the first published reviews comes from Metal Planet Music, which awarded the album an impressive 9/10 rating, praising the band’s willingness to evolve while still maintaining the core sound that has defined Evanescence for more than two decades. According to the review, Sanctuary is one of the band’s most adventurous releases yet, blending heavy guitars, electronic elements, cinematic atmosphere, and Amy Lee’s unmistakable vocals into a fresh and ambitious collection of songs.

Other early reviews have echoed similar sentiments. Kerrang! described the album as another example of Evanescence’s “quality over quantity” approach, highlighting its dramatic and cinematic style. Meanwhile, Metal Hammer called Sanctuary the band’s most vital album in years, praising its modern production, heavier edge, and confident songwriting.

The album features twelve tracks, including the singles “Who Will You Follow” and “Afterlife”, and marks Evanescence’s first full studio album since The Bitter Truth in 2021.

With multiple reviewers praising its ambition, energy, and contemporary sound, Sanctuary is shaping up to be one of the most celebrated Evanescence releases in recent memory. Fans will finally be able to hear the full album when it arrives on June 5.

Evanescence Shares “Who Will You Follow” Behind The Scenes Video

Evanescence Shares “Who Will You Follow” Behind The Scenes Video

Evanescence have released a new behind the scenes look at the making of their latest music video, “Who Will You Follow.”

In a post shared on X, the band thanked fans for the overwhelming support the video has received since its release and directed fans to a new making-of feature now available on their official YouTube channel.

“The amount of love we’ve received for our new music video for ‘Who Will You Follow,’ directed by Jensen Noen, has been unbelievable. THANK YOU!” the band wrote.

The behind the scenes video gives fans a closer look at how the music video came together, including filming moments, studio footage, and production clips featuring the band throughout the shoot.

“Who Will You Follow” is the lead single from Evanescence’s upcoming album Sanctuary, set for release on June 5, 2026. The song’s official music video has continued gaining momentum online following its recent debut.

“Who Will You Follow” Official Music Video Out Now!

“Who Will You Follow” Official Music Video Out Now!

Evanescence have officially released the music video for “Who Will You Follow”, the lead single from their upcoming album Sanctuary, due out June 5.

The video premiered today on the band’s official YouTube channel, bringing the dark and cinematic visuals fans have been anticipating since the song’s release in April. The track has already become one of the band’s biggest recent releases, earning praise for its heavier sound and emotional intensity.

“Who Will You Follow” was produced by Zakk Cervini and Jordan Fish and serves as the latest preview of Sanctuary, Evanescence’s sixth studio album.

Evanescence announce “Who Will You Follow” music video premiere

Evanescence announce “Who Will You Follow” music video premiere

Evanescence have officially announced that the music video for their new single “Who Will You Follow” will premiere tomorrow, following a teaser posted across the band’s social media accounts. The track is the lead single from their upcoming album Sanctuary, due out June 5.

After weeks of anticipation, Evanescence have officially confirmed that the music video for their latest single, Who Will You Follow, will premiere tomorrow.

The announcement was made through the band’s social media accounts alongside a dark and cryptic teaser for the upcoming video, featuring the line: “The rats in the wall are already coming through…” The short clip immediately sparked excitement among fans, many of whom have been eagerly awaiting the visual companion to the song since its release in April.

“Who Will You Follow” serves as the lead single from Evanescence’s upcoming sixth studio album, Sanctuary, which arrives June 5, 2026. The song has already continued to gain momentum online and across streaming platforms, becoming one of the band’s fastest-growing releases in recent years.

The upcoming music video will mark the first official visual release from the Sanctuary era and is expected to expand on the dark imagery and themes teased throughout the album campaign so far.

Amy Lee Says One Song on Evanescence’s New Album ‘Sanctuary’ Was Inspired by ‘Fallen’

Amy Lee Says One Song on Evanescence’s New Album ‘Sanctuary’ Was Inspired by ‘Fallen’

Amy Lee Reflects on Evanescence’s Early Years

As anticipation continues to build for Evanescence’s upcoming album Sanctuary, Amy Lee has opened up about how revisiting the band’s past unexpectedly shaped one of the record’s new songs.

In a new interview featured in Rock Sound Issue 319, Lee revealed that the track “Forever Without You” was deeply influenced by revisiting material from Evanescence’s 2003 debut album Fallen.

“Going through old audio, old video, watching old music videos, listening to demos of songs when we were still doing it ourselves. It was a lot of feelings for me,” Lee explained.

“And I did end up right out of that writing this one particular song that feels like it had to be 20 years later for me to be in the place to write it.”

A New Perspective on ‘Fallen’

Lee also reflected on how her perspective on Fallen has evolved over time, especially while working with new collaborators who grew up loving the album.

“I’m able to see everything from back then with more of a lens of love now,” she said.

“Part of that has come from me going through it all, but then another part of it has come through working with these new collaborators who love our music and love ‘Fallen’ and see it through a different lens.”

She continued by saying that she has often viewed the band’s past through a more critical perspective. Now, she feels more at peace with embracing every part of that era.

“There is a little bit of an emotional component where I’m finally in a place where there’s no running from it anymore. It’s all of it. All that I’ve always been, all the things that I didn’t know I loved about it. I’m able to see them through a new lens of love.”

‘Sanctuary’ Releases June 5

Sanctuary will be released on June 5, 2026. The album’s lead single “Who Will You Follow” arrived on April 10, 2026.

Fans have already started speculating about how much of Evanescence’s classic sound may return throughout the record.

The comments from Amy Lee suggest that Forever Without You could become one of the album’s most emotional and reflective moments, connecting Evanescence’s past with where the band is today.

Evanescence Featured on the Cover of Rock Sound Magazine

Evanescence Featured on the Cover of Rock Sound Magazine

Evanescence are featured on the cover of the latest issue of Rock Sound, marking another major milestone in the band’s current era as they prepare for the release of their upcoming album Sanctuary.

In the feature, Amy Lee discusses the creative process behind Sanctuary, explaining how new collaborators and a fresh perspective helped shape the direction of the album. The band drew from both personal experiences and broader themes, channeling those ideas into a record that balances intensity with a sense of purpose.

The lead single, Who Will You Follow, is highlighted as a key part of that vision, reflecting the tone and message of the new material.

Sanctuary is scheduled for release on June 5, 2026, and will serve as the follow-up to The Bitter Truth.

Amy Lee Opens Up About Evanescence’s “Sanctuary” Era in New Kerrang! Interview

Amy Lee Opens Up About Evanescence’s “Sanctuary” Era in New Kerrang! Interview

Evanescence are entering a powerful new chapter, and in a recent interview with Kerrang!, Amy Lee gave fans one of the most honest looks yet at the band’s upcoming album Sanctuary and the emotions behind it.

After years of writing and recording, Sanctuary is finally ready to be heard. According to Amy, this album has been a long time coming, shaped by both personal struggles and the state of the world around her.

A Creative Escape That Became Something Bigger

During the interview, Amy described Sanctuary as more than just a collection of songs. It became a place she could escape to when everything else felt overwhelming. Writing music gave her a sense of control during uncertain times, and that feeling is woven throughout the album.

She also shared that she became completely immersed in the process, at times stepping away from everything else just to focus on finishing lyrics and shaping the record into what it needed to be.

Years in the Making

Sanctuary wasn’t created overnight. The album took shape over the course of several years, with sessions happening between tours and across different locations. That time allowed the songs to evolve naturally, giving the band space to experiment and refine their sound.

The result is something that still feels unmistakably Evanescence, while also pushing forward into new territory.

“Who Will You Follow” Sets the Tone

The lead single Who Will You Follow offers a strong introduction to the album’s themes. The song dives into ideas of influence, leadership, and the choices people make when they are searching for direction.

It carries the emotional weight fans expect from Evanescence, but with a sharper, more urgent edge that reflects the current moment.

A Modern Sound Without Losing Identity

While Sanctuary builds on the band’s signature mix of rock, piano, and atmospheric elements, it also embraces a more modern production style. Collaborations with producers like Jordan Fish and Zakk Cervini helped shape a heavier and more current sound, without losing what makes Evanescence unique.

That balance between evolution and identity is something Amy clearly values, and it shows in the way she talks about the album.

Ready to Share It With the World

One of the strongest takeaways from the interview is just how much this album means to her. Amy spoke about feeling both proud and relieved to finally release music that she and the band have been deeply connected to for so long.

For fans, Sanctuary is shaping up to be more than just a new album. It feels like a statement. A reflection of everything the band has been through, and a reminder of why their music continues to connect in such a real way.

Sanctuary is set to be released June 5, 2026.

Is “Beautiful Lie” the Next Evanescence Single?

Is “Beautiful Lie” the Next Evanescence Single?

A new detail spotted on the BMG website may be hinting at what’s next for Evanescence’s upcoming album Sanctuary.

According to a recent listing on BMG’s official site, the band’s new single “Who Will You Follow” is described as a preview of the album, which is set to release on June 5. However, the listing also includes an interesting note. It references other songs on the album and specifically mentions “Beautiful Lie” as a previously released single.

This has caught fans’ attention, since “Beautiful Lie” has not yet been officially released or promoted as a single by the band.


What Does This Mean?

The mention of “Beautiful Lie” alongside “Afterlife” as a previously released track could suggest a few possibilities:

  • The song may be planned as the next official single from Sanctuary
  • It could have been internally categorized as a single ahead of release
  • Or it may simply be an early listing error on BMG’s site

At this time, there has been no official confirmation from Evanescence or their team regarding “Beautiful Lie” as the next single.


Sanctuary Era Continues

Sanctuary, Evanescence’s highly anticipated new album, arrives June 5 and marks the band’s latest era following the release of “Who Will You Follow”.

The BMG page also highlights the success of “Afterlife”, which reached No. 1 on the Billboard Mainstream Rock Airplay chart and the Mediabase Active Rock chart in the United States and Canada.

With momentum already building, fans are closely watching for what comes next and “Beautiful Lie” may be the next piece of the puzzle.


Final Thoughts

While nothing is confirmed yet, this small detail from BMG has definitely sparked speculation. If “Beautiful Lie” is indeed the next single, an announcement could be coming soon as the countdown to Sanctuary continues.

Amy Lee Opens Up About Sanctuary: “We’ve Been Obsessing Over This Music”

Amy Lee Opens Up About Sanctuary: “We’ve Been Obsessing Over This Music”

Evanescence are officially entering a new era with their upcoming sixth studio album, Sanctuary, and according to Amy Lee, the journey to this release has been deeply personal and long in the making.

In a recent interview Abe Kanan of Audacy Music highlighted by Blabbermouth, Lee shared just how meaningful this album is after years of work behind the scenes.

A project years in the making

Sanctuary did not come together overnight. The album has reportedly been in development for over three years, evolving through different creative phases and emotional moments.

Lee described the process as intense but rewarding, explaining that revisiting the finished album now feels overwhelming in the best way. She expressed pride in the final result and emphasized how much effort and passion went into every detail.

More than just a collection of songs, the album became a creative outlet during uncertain times, allowing her to process emotions and channel them into something powerful and meaningful.

Music as an emotional outlet

Throughout the writing and recording process, Lee leaned heavily on music as a way to cope with things that felt out of control. She explained that working on Sanctuary helped her transform those feelings into something hopeful and connective.

That emotional depth has always been a core part of Evanescence’s sound, and this new era appears to continue that tradition while pushing the band forward creatively.

“Obsessed” with the final result

One of the most striking takeaways from the interview is just how invested Lee has been in this album. She said the band has been “obsessing over” the music for a long time, which reflects how deeply connected they are to the project.

That level of dedication suggests Sanctuary could be one of the band’s most refined and intentional releases yet.

The next chapter begins

The release of Sanctuary marks the next major chapter for Evanescence. Alongside the album rollout, the band has also shared new material, including the single “Who Will You Follow”.

With the album set to arrive on June 5th, anticipation continues to build as fans prepare for what could be one of the band’s most impactful releases yet.
